Core Viewpoint - The announcement details a passive dilution of shareholding percentages for the controlling shareholder and actual controllers of Jiangsu Huahong Technology Co., Ltd. due to the conversion of convertible bonds into shares, without any change in the number of shares held by these shareholders [1][3]. Summary by Sections Basic Situation of Equity Change - Jiangsu Huahong Technology Co., Ltd. issued convertible bonds totaling 515 million yuan, with each bond having a face value of 100 yuan, approved by the China Securities Regulatory Commission [1]. - The bonds were listed for trading on January 10, 2023, and the conversion into shares began on June 8, 2023 [1]. Details of Shareholding Changes - The total number of shares increased by 14,203,455, raising the total share capital from 586,923,372 to 601,126,827 shares [3]. - The shareholding percentage of the controlling shareholder and actual controllers decreased from 39.89% to 38.94% due to this dilution [3]. Specific Shareholding Information - Jiangsu Huahong Industrial Group Co., Ltd. and its associated individuals (Hu Shiyong, Hu Shiqing, and Hu Shifa) maintained their number of shares but experienced a dilution in their ownership percentage [4]. - The specific shareholding before and after the change is as follows: - Jiangsu Huahong Industrial Group Co., Ltd.: - Before: 200,884,632 shares (34.61%) - After: 200,884,632 shares (33.79%) - Hu Shiyong: - Before: 15,126,345 shares (2.61%) - After: 15,126,345 shares (2.54%) - Hu Shiqing: - Before: 7,757,100 shares (1.34%) - After: 7,757,100 shares (1.30%) - Hu Shifa: - Before: 7,757,100 shares (1.34%) - After: 7,757,100 shares (1.30%) [4]. Impact of the Change - The equity change does not alter the control of the company, nor does it significantly impact the governance structure or ongoing operations of Jiangsu Huahong Technology Co., Ltd.
